What happens if you don’t pay PalmPay loan?

We have seen several memes made out of PalmPay officials supposedly harassing and arresting people who have failed their loans. It has almost become a trend on social media for PalmPay officials tracking down loan defaulters and arresting them.

The truth is PalmPay are not in the business of harassing loan defaulters, however, they do take some steps to ensure that you pay back your loan.

For example, they have a security plugin, that prevents you from using your mobile phone, should you fail to pay back your loan.

They also have the option of reporting you to the credit bureau, which will prevent you from getting loans in the future.

You should always make sure that you will be able to repay a loan before you take it, to avoid any of the above actions that can be taken against you.
